About Spring Valley
A Diverse East County Community for Rental Owners
Spring Valley is an established East County community located east of San Diego and Lemon Grove. The area includes a mix of established residential neighborhoods, hillside properties, single-family homes, condos, and other rental housing options.
The community’s location provides access to major transportation routes and nearby areas including La Mesa, Lemon Grove, El Cajon, and San Diego. Its variety of housing and neighborhood settings creates different opportunities for rental property owners.
Because Spring Valley is an unincorporated community, property owners can benefit from working with a management team that understands the differences between its individual neighborhoods and rental properties.

Spring Valley Property Management FAQs
What property types do you manage in Spring Valley?
Our services can support residential rental properties such as single-family homes, condos, townhomes, and other qualifying rental properties. Service availability depends on the property.
How can I find out how much rent my Spring Valley property could generate?
A rental analysis can consider factors such as location, property size, condition, amenities, housing type, and comparable rentals to help establish an appropriate pricing strategy.
Do you find tenants for Spring Valley rental properties?
Yes. Our leasing support can include rental marketing, inquiry management, property showings, application processing, tenant screening, and move-in coordination.
How do you handle maintenance requests?
Tenants can report maintenance concerns, and we coordinate the appropriate response. Depending on the issue, this may involve troubleshooting, vendor coordination, repair work, or follow-up.
